Pava is a natural substance that is derived from the kava plant, scientifically known as Piper methysticum The kava plant is native to the South Pacific islands, where it has been used for centuries in traditional medicine and cultural rituals The roots of the kava plant are harvested and processed to extract the active compounds, which are then used to make Pava.

Pava is most commonly consumed as a beverage, which is made by mixing the powdered Pava root with water The resulting drink has a slightly bitter taste and is often described as having a calming effect on the body and mind In the South Pacific islands, Pava is traditionally consumed in social gatherings or ceremonies as a way to promote relaxation and sociability.

One of the main active compounds in Pava is called kavalactones, which are believed to be responsible for the plant’s medicinal properties Kavalactones have been studied for their potential anti-anxiety, sedative, and muscle-relaxant effects Some research suggests that Pava may help reduce symptoms of anxiety and stress, improve sleep quality, and promote relaxation without impairing cognitive function.

In addition to its potential mental health benefits, Pava has also been used for its analgesic properties Traditional healers in the South Pacific islands have used Pava to relieve pain and inflammation, making it a popular remedy for conditions such as arthritis and muscle soreness Some studies have suggested that Pava may have similar pain-relieving effects to prescription medications, but more research is needed to confirm these findings.

Some preliminary research has suggested that Pava may help reduce cravings for substances such as alcohol and nicotine, making it a potential tool for individuals seeking to overcome addiction However, further studies are needed to fully understand the effects of Pava on addictive behaviors.

Despite its potential benefits, it’s important to note that Pava is not without its risks The consumption of Pava has been associated with a few side effects, including nausea, dizziness, and liver toxicity In rare cases, excessive consumption of Pava has been linked to a condition called kava dermopathy, which causes dry, scaly skin and yellow discoloration of the nails As such, it’s essential to use Pava in moderation and consult with a healthcare provider before incorporating it into your wellness routine.

In recent years, Pava has gained popularity in Western countries as an alternative remedy for various health conditions It can now be found in various forms, including capsules, tinctures, and extracts, making it more accessible to a wider audience However, it’s crucial to purchase Pava from reputable sources to ensure quality and safety.
